New Delhi: Five people were killed after a Haryana-registered Mahindra Scorpio SUV lost control and plunged into the Chenab River in Jammu and Kashmir’s Kishtwar district on Saturday.
The tragic accident took place in the Dachhan area when the vehicle, bearing registration number HR29 AG 0648, was travelling from Dangdaru to Sounder. According to officials, the SUV skidded off the road near Yenwan in Dangdaru at around 10:50 am before falling into the river.
Soon after receiving information about the accident, teams from the Dachhan Police Station, along with local residents and volunteers, reached the spot and started rescue operations.
Officials said efforts were made to locate and evacuate the occupants of the vehicle. The injured, if any, were shifted to nearby medical facilities, while further details about the victims were awaited.
Authorities have not yet released the identities of those killed in the accident. Rescue and relief operations continued as officials gathered more information about the incident.
The accident has once again highlighted the challenges of driving on the mountainous roads of Jammu and Kashmir, where sharp turns, difficult terrain and unpredictable conditions often pose risks to commuters. Further details are awaited from the administration and police officials.
